Record-breaking attendance in Border-Gavaskar Trophy leaves Ravi Shastri, Ricky Ponting in awe | Cricket News

Former cricket stars Ravi Shastri and Ricky Ponting have praised the record-breaking attendance at the recent five-match Test series between India and Australia. They suggested this rivalry might now surpass the Ashes in significance.Australia triumphed 3-1, ending India’s decade-long dominance of the Border-Gavaskar Trophy. The series attracted a remarkable 837,000 spectators across the five Tests….
